Air Travel Strong at MSP This Summer And Busy Holiday Weekend Expected

(Minneapolis, MN) -- Air travel at Minneapolis-St. Paul International Airport is spiking and is expected to rise more over the Labor Day weekend.  

Metropolitan Airports Commission CEO Brian Ryks says that he is seeing stronger summer travel, with some days in July exceeding 2019 figures. He adds that the impact of COVID variants on fall air travel remains uncertain.  

Officials say Friday was the busiest of the holiday weekend with 31 thousand bookings, compared to 15-thousand-800 this same day last year.
